Klaus Seewald has worked with the Austrian company Theatre ASOU since 1995, firstly as an actor and subsequently as an actor, director and trainer.

Rooted in Eugenio Barba’s Theatre Anthropology, and developed in collaboration with the former artistic director and founder of the theatre company (Theater ASOU) Abel Solares (Teatro Vivo, Guatemala), Theatre ASOU has worked with a variety of teachers/directors from various backgrounds to realize its own theatrical mode of work as well as exploratory workshops and performance projects.

Since 1998, Klaus has assisted his teacher Phillip B. Zarrilli at workshops as well as Lecture Demonstrations, including “best-off-styria” (Graz, Austria), “London International Workshop Festival“ (London, UK), “Center for Performance Research“ (Aberystwyth, UK), “Grotowski Center“ (Wroclaw, Poland) and “Theatre Training and Research Programm” (Singapore). In 2000 he was awarded permission to teach Kalarippayattu, a South Indian Martial Art, which he uses as a base for his approach to theatre/dance. Since then he has given workshops for LAUT!, for the Theater im Bahnhof as well as leading an ongoing Kalari class in his home-base Graz. He is currently collaborating with ARBOS (based in Salzburg, Austria), a company creating theatre for a hearing and non-hearing audience.
